Output eece955656c608590786bff9ea281bcd6bf41d38c543e828270dda5a6ae8fb1b:122

value
7927
script pubkey
OP_0 OP_PUSHBYTES_20 c2bc4ca03e22ea171ee216dec71defdb6a9316b5
address
bc1qc27yegp7yt4pw8hzzm0vw800md4fx944cs8lan
transaction
eece955656c608590786bff9ea281bcd6bf41d38c543e828270dda5a6ae8fb1b
confirmations
38409
spent
true